Taipei Mayor Ko Wen-je went to visit Taipei’s sister city of Phoenix, Arizona on Monday. He was met by Arizona Secretary of State Michele Reagan who greeted him with a friendly hug. But when asked about it afterward, Mayor Ko said he wasn’t used to that type of greeting.
Taipei and Phoenix have been sister cities for 37 years. Thus, it wasn’t unusual for Reagan to greet him with a friendly hug. Phoenix Mayor Greg Stanton also treated Mayor Ko to a lunch banquet.
After the banquet, when speaking with the press, Ko said he was not used to being greeted with a hug. People also spoke of Mayor Ko’s cycling from the northern capital of Taipei all the way to the southern port city of Kaohsiung in one day. Stanton’s assistant’s wife plans to cycle the same route next week. But Ko suggested that she take her time and give herself 3 days for the route.
Mayor Ko said he loves the sunny weather in Phoenix. He encouraged them to visit Taipei and said they would probably love Taipei as much as he loves Phoenix.
